Global Screw Making Machines Market to Reach US$5.7 Billion by 2030
The global market for Screw Making Machines estimated at US$5.1 Billion in the year 2024, is expected to reach US$5.7 Billion by 2030, growing at a CAGR of 1.9% over the analysis period 2024-2030. Automatic Machine, one of the segments analyzed in the report, is expected to record a 2.2% CAGR and reach US$3.3 Billion by the end of the analysis period. Growth in the Semi-automatic Machine segment is estimated at 1.3% CAGR over the analysis period.
The U.S. Market is Estimated at US$1.4 Billion While China is Forecast to Grow at 3.6% CAGR
The Screw Making Machines market in the U.S. is estimated at US$1.4 Billion in the year 2024. China, the world's second largest economy, is forecast to reach a projected market size of US$1.1 Billion by the year 2030 trailing a CAGR of 3.6% over the analysis period 2024-2030. Among the other noteworthy geographic markets are Japan and Canada, each forecast to grow at a CAGR of 0.7% and 1.6% respectively over the analysis period. Within Europe, Germany is forecast to grow at approximately 1.1% CAGR.

How Are Screw Making Machines Supporting Global Manufacturing Expansion?
Screw making machines form a foundational element in the hardware supply chain, enabling the mass production of fasteners essential to construction, automotive, electronics, and machinery industries. As manufacturing volumes rise globally, so does the need for high-precision, high-throughput screw production equipment. These machines automate processes such as wire feeding, heading, threading, and heat treatment with minimal manual intervention. Manufacturers depend on them for producing consistent quality across a variety of screw types-wood screws, self-tapping screws, machine screws, and specialty fasteners. The machines play a crucial role in enabling rapid assembly lines and minimizing mechanical failure through dimensional precision. As industries demand lighter yet stronger fasteners for efficiency and miniaturization, screw machines are evolving to meet new metallurgical and design standards. Their role is central in ensuring both cost control and performance reliability in mass-scale production environments.
What Technological Innovations Are Enhancing Machine Output and Flexibility?
The latest generation of screw making machines incorporates CNC programming, servo motors, and automated quality control systems. These features enable micron-level accuracy and adaptability for complex geometries. Modular designs are allowing manufacturers to switch between different screw sizes and head types with minimal downtime. Vision systems and digital sensors are embedded for in-process inspection and real-time defect detection. AI algorithms are being tested for predictive maintenance and adaptive process optimization. High-speed threading units and automatic lubrication systems are improving throughput without increasing machine wear. Some machines are now equipped with IoT connectivity, enabling remote monitoring, performance analytics, and software updates. All-electric screw machines are emerging in response to energy efficiency regulations. These innovations are shifting the landscape from bulk manufacturing to agile, data-informed production.
Which End-User Sectors Are Fueling Market Expansion?
Automotive manufacturing, with its high-volume, safety-critical components, remains a key demand center. Electronics and consumer appliance industries are driving miniaturization in screw dimensions, creating a market for ultra-precise equipment. Aerospace and defense require specialized machines capable of producing high-tolerance, corrosion-resistant fasteners. The growth in infrastructure and urban housing has led to demand for construction-grade screws at scale. Furniture and DIY markets are increasingly turning to regional manufacturers using compact screw machines for localized supply. The medical device industry, requiring sterile and biocompatible fasteners, is another fast-growing niche. Contract manufacturers and SMEs are also investing in cost-effective, semi-automated systems to cater to custom or small-batch needs. The diversity of end-use scenarios is pushing screw machine manufacturers to offer scalable, modular, and tech-integrated solutions.
The Growth In The Screw Making Machines Market Is Driven By Several Factors...
Global manufacturing expansion, fueled by reshoring, automation, and demand for localized production, is a major catalyst. Increasing focus on product standardization and fastener quality is prompting investments in precision machinery. Environmental regulations and energy-efficiency goals are supporting the adoption of newer, cleaner technologies. Emerging markets in Southeast Asia, Africa, and Eastern Europe are investing in domestic hardware manufacturing capabilities. The rise of modular construction and prefabrication in civil engineering is further stimulating fastener demand. Government incentives and industrial policy reforms in countries like India and Vietnam are lowering barriers for machine tool acquisition. Additionally, the aging fleet of legacy screw machines in developed economies is creating a replacement market for smart, connected alternatives. These combined forces point to sustained and geographically diverse market growth.
